What companies run services between Hisar, India and Anand Vihar ISBT Terminal, India?

Indian Railways operates a train from Hisar to New Delhi 3 times a day. Tickets cost ₹170–1,400 and the journey takes 4h 30m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Hisar to Anand Vihar ISBT Terminal via Delhi, Old Delhi station, and ISBT Anand Vihar in around 6h 1m.
